Ma Anand Sheela (born December 28, 1949) is an Indian‑Swiss former personal secretary to Bhagwan Shree Rajneesh, better known as Osho. In the early 1980s she effectively ran his Oregon commune, controlling daily operations, finances, and the group’s political and legal strategies. In 1986, she pleaded guilty to attempted murder for her role in the 1984 Rajneeshee bioterror attack, as well as assault, wire‑tapping, arson, and immigration fraud. After serving her sentence, she relocated to Switzerland, where she has lived since. While critics portray her as manipulative or even villainous, others point to her loyalty, charisma, and formidableness making her a controversial figure.
